Pte. Arthur Ernest Hamper 6286695 The Buffs (1/Royal East Kent Regiment) 50 Me Commando.


Pte. Arthur Hamper of the East Kents was taken prisoner during Operation Abstention, the attempt to capture the Dodecanese island of Kastelorizo and ended up in Stalag IVF at Hartmannsdorf bei Chemnitz, Saxony in Germany, he was previously recorded to have been in P.G. 102 an Italian camp at L?Aquilla near the Apenine Mountains. On the 25th June 1944 he was shot by the Germans for an escape attempt and rebellion. He is today buried in the Berlin 1939-1945 War Cemetery plot 10.Z.7.
